Hello I'm looking for some high quality dies for the RCBS Rockchucker Supreme or the Redding Big Boss II, I heard Redding has very good quality dies. What are your recommendations, also where to buy?

I'm also thinking of getting the Hornady LnL bushing for easier swap, will this influence the quality of the ammo produced? I heard some people say that it has some wiggle which might be good, other people say is better just to screw your dies to the press.

If you are reloading for precision shooting, Forster Benchrest or Redding Type-s. And forget about the LNL bushings. If you are reloading for hunting or plinking, then RCBS and Hornady are valid brands and you can use the LNL bushings.
 
I use a mix of dies actually

My Neck size die is Lee
Body size die Redding
Micrometer seating die Forster

Very happy with this trio so far

And do you do resizing in 2 steps? One for body only and one for neck only?


Exactly
Resize body to bump 2 thou (assuming its bolt action rifle),
And then resize necks seperately.

I confirm that all my reloaded 308 ammo, is sub 1 thou runout that way, which is cool to have!

To be honest not much reason, mokey see mokey do type of thing.
But, with this die combo, doesn’t mean it cannot be done with other dies, i have 0.5 thou runout avg, and that on a cheap Lee press.
Recently upgraded my press to a deluxe Forster co-ax, did not change my ammo quality one single bit.
These dies work hard and well no matter if they are screwed on a 100$ Lee press or 500$ Forster press

YMMV but I use a four step process to control run out and bump. I body size without bumping the shoulders, I have another bump die just to set the shoulders back, then I neck size with the Lee Collet Die I use different custom mandrel diameters to control the neck tension and seat with a Forster Microseater. Using a Co-ax press see my run out on a 0.0005" dial indicator if video below.
